Form 4: Atlassian CEO Michael Cannon-Brookes Executes Stock Sales Under 10b5-1 Trading Plan
SEC Form 4
Atlassian CEO Michael Cannon-Brookes sold shares of Class A Common Stock on February 20, 2025, under a pre-arranged Rule 10b5-1 trading plan.
Summary
- Michael Cannon-Brookes, CEO and Co-Founder of Atlassian Corp, executed multiple sales of Class A Common Stock on February 20, 2025.
- The sales were conducted under a pre-arranged Rule 10b5-1 trading plan adopted on February 8, 2024.
- The transactions involved the disposal of shares held indirectly by the Cannon-Brookes Head Trust, with CBC Co Pty Limited as trustee.
- The sales occurred at varying prices throughout the day, ranging from $294.35 to $302.30 per share.
- A total of 8,148 shares were sold across multiple transactions.
- Following the reported transactions, the number of shares beneficially owned indirectly by the trust decreased.

Industry Context
Sales by insiders are a common occurrence and are often pre-planned to avoid accusations of insider trading. The use of a 10b5-1 plan allows insiders to sell shares at predetermined times and prices.
